Slovak Trust Fund / ACUImportant documentsPolicy and Institutional Background The Ministry of Foreign Affairs of the Slovak Republic (MFA) and the United Nations Development Programme (UNDP) have established Slovak-UNDP Trust Fund (TF) as one component of the Slovak National Official Development Assistance Programme (ODA). An Administrative and Contracting Unit (ACU) has been established within the TF as an ODA delivery mechanism to support national capacity building in the field of ODA, under the leadership and supervision of the Trust Fund Steering Committee (TFSC). The TF project is executed and implemented directly by the UNDP Regional Center in Bratislava. It operates as a separate project, managed byTFSC while making full use of the UNDP Regional Support Center's administrative and financial capacities. The role of the Ministry of Foreign Affairs of Slovak Republic is strategic management and decision-making in ACU"s activities. ACU’s task is strengthening national capacities for development cooperation, supporting development education, public awareness and national development constituency. ACU has no decision-making responsibility in deciding for funding Slovak ODA activities.The implementation of the tasks of the ACU is set up in the frame of priorities approved by the TFSC.
